Justin Bieber's bodyguard aggravates surfers in Australia - report

Justin Bieber reportedly incurred the wrath of surfers during a trip to a beach in Australia this week (beg25Nov13) when one of the singer's bodyguards allegedly snatched a cell phone from a spectator.


The Baby hitmaker enjoyed a surfing lesson in Byron Bay on Wednesday (27Nov13), and his antics on the beach attracted a crowd of onlookers all eager to snap a picture of the star.


Surfer Kes Weartherm claims one of Bieber's bodyguards snatched his cell phone away after he caught him taking pictures, and he tells TMZ.com that a group of angry bystanders had to badger the security supervisor into handing the device back.


Bieber later posted his own pictures of his surfing experience on his Instagram.com page.


The news comes just days after one of Bieber's bodyguards was arrested for allegedly assaulting a photographer during a beach outing in Hawaii last week (21Nov13).


Dwayne Patterson, 29, was charged with third degree assault and fourth degree criminal property damage for allegedly grabbing a snapper's camera and damaging the device after the owner refused to delete pictures of the star.


Patterson was released on $3,000 bail.
